Population in Lipnik Municipality 2022

In 2022, Lipnik municipality ranked 1826 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Population shrank by 473 residents -8.89% between 2017-2022, at 4,849.

Among 1984 declining municipalities, in bottom 20% for rate of decline. Within Opatowski county, ranked 4 of 8 municipalities.

Based on 31 years of official GUS statistics for Opatowski county municipalities within Holy Cross province.
